Layla's mother has died. She misses her mother so much. Layla wants to fly on the back of a bird to see her mother again. Her wish comes true one special night when she has a magical dream. When she wakes up, Layla tells her grandmother about her dream. Did she really fly on the back of a bird? Did she really see her mommy again? Missing Mommy is a beautiful story on love, loss, and healing. Written for one special girl many years ago, Missing Mommy is now dedicated to all children everywhere.

Diane Kaufman, MD is a poet, artist, and child psychiatrist. Her passion and gift is transforming trauma into creativity. She is the founder and director of Arts Medicine for Health & Healing. Her story, Bird That Wants to Fly, inspired a children's opera by composer Michael Raphael, performed by Trilogy: An Opera Company, and narrated by the actor, Danny Glover. Dr. Kaufman has been honored for her practice of humanism in medicine, and presents internationally on arts and healing.
